Output 81ad574e326962da1b60412d03dbc70c985935092b2d74230a87ff379c037d59:1

value
95601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c567248120a7a6fff338dd0c53f471f23b798ca1 OP_EQUAL
address
3Kgnbonhuo9kaeJpBEiAnwM51GHbC2mXK8
transaction
81ad574e326962da1b60412d03dbc70c985935092b2d74230a87ff379c037d59
spent
true